Personally, I love art classes. First off you are given all day access to a studio where you can not worry about being messy. You get to interact with other artists, whom there is lots to learn from. And if you do some research you can get some very qualified teachers. Projects are an easy way to help build your portfolio. On top of that, you can experience all these different mediums that you could only dream of trying because equipment is so damn expensive, like glassblowing.
